Data recovery is perhaps the most intimidating challenge that IT organizations face. They must keep important information available and protected, even as the amount of data grows at rapid speed.


Organizations must dedicate more and more resources to protect e-mail, databases, application data and then factor in regulatory compliance and ever-increasing financial pressures. Data deduplication can help by increasing availability, reducing costs and ensuring business continuity.
